Shearing Machine Blades – High-Strength Blades for Accurate and Consistent Metal Cutting

Shearing Machine Blades are engineered for industries that require clean, accurate, and stable cutting of sheet metal, steel plates, aluminium sheets, and various industrial materials. These blades are manufactured using high-grade alloy steel, high-carbon steel, or tool steel to deliver long-term durability, uniform hardness, and exceptional resistance to wear. Designed for metal fabrication units, engineering workshops, automotive components, and industrial manufacturing, these blades ensure smooth and consistent shearing performance across different material thicknesses.

Each blade is precision-ground to maintain accurate cutting geometry, straight edges, and correct tolerances. This reduces cutting load, prevents burr formation, and supports smooth machine operation. The controlled heat-treatment process provides balanced hardness, which helps the blade maintain sharpness and structural stability during continuous heavy-duty cutting.
Shearing Machine Blades are compatible with mechanical, hydraulic, and guillotine shearing machines used across fabrication and industrial cutting lines. Their solid construction ensures clean shearing without distortion, bending, or uneven pressure distribution.

Every blade undergoes strict quality testing for hardness, flatness, thickness, and surface finish to ensure consistent industrial performance. These blades help improve productivity, reduce rework, and support long operational cycles with minimal maintenance.
